Sarah is considering purchasing a condominium unit in Atlanta and wants to understand her ownership rights. Under the Georgia Condominium Act, what does Sarah actually own when she purchases a condominium unit?

Correct Answer

D) Her individual unit plus an undivided interest in the common elements

Correct: D - Her individual unit plus an undivided interest in the common elements. Under the Georgia Condominium Act, a unit owner owns their individual unit in fee simple plus an undivided interest in the common elements as tenants in common with other unit owners.
